
"2024: A Pivotal Year for Elections, Climate, and Global Events"
Experts predict a year of extremes in fashion, with luxury and sustainability at the forefront, and political slogan T-shirts making a comeback. The UK may see an election in autumn, while climate action will be a key issue in major elections worldwide, with a "super El Niño" expected to cause record heat and environmental challenges. In entertainment, adaptations of significant novels will dominate screens, and the West End will feature star-studded performances. Technology will see a shift from the hype of generative AI to practical applications, and electric vehicle sales will continue to outpace infrastructure. The US presidential election will be closely watched, with potential for a Trump return, while China's Xi Jinping may face internal challenges. A global surge in elections could bolster authoritarian and populist-nationalist leaders. The cost of living crisis will persist, with energy bills and food prices as key concerns, while Taylor Swift's UK tour could boost the economy. Sports events like the Paris Olympics and Euro 2024 will captivate audiences, with England's football team among the favorites.
